Explanation of number 9150 Prime Factorization
Prime Factorization of 9150 it is expressing 9150 as the product of prime factors. In other words it is finding which prime numbers should be multiplied together to make 9150.
Since number 9150 is a Composite number (not Prime) we can do its Prime Factorization.
To get a list of all Prime Factors of 9150, we have to iteratively divide 9150 by the smallest prime number possible until the result equals 1.
Here is the complete solution of finding Prime Factors of 9150:
The smallest Prime Number which can divide 9150 without a remainder is 2. So the first calculation step would look like:
9150 ÷ 2 = 4575
Now we repeat this action until the result equals 1:
4575 ÷ 3 = 1525
1525 ÷ 5 = 305
305 ÷ 5 = 61
61 ÷ 61 = 1
Now we have all the Prime Factors for number 9150. It is: 2, 3, 5, 5, 61
Or you may also write it in exponential form: 2 × 3 × 52 × 61
